Sun Trevor Barn 1, Llangollen

Clwyd. Sleeps up to 4

Llangollen 1.5 miles. Nestled on the outskirts of Llangollen in Denbighshire, is this fantastic two-bedroom barn conversion, Barn 1. Enjoying a brilliant location with valley views from the private enclosed patio and an open-plan layout, Barn 1 makes for an idyllic dwelling for a family of four or two couples and their furry friend to explore North Wales. Park up in one of two convenient off-road parking spaces, before unloading your bags and stepping into your new holiday home. Be greeted by a light and airy open-plan living space, where you can look forward to testing out your favourite recipes in the well-equipped kitchen with electric oven and hob and fridge/freezer. Set the table and pour the wine, as you keep the designated chef company, before settling down with your guests around the dining table to toast to a wonderful holiday and savour a lovely meal. Snuggle up on the plush corner sofa and find your favourite TV show on the wall-mounted TV or savour the last of the day’s sunshine with evening drinks out on the private patio followed by a dip in the bubbling hot tub. As your eyes grow heavy, climb the stairs to the first-floor where you will find two well-presented bedrooms, a double and a triple bunk, both perfect for catching your rest in. Wake-up with a refreshing shower and prepare for the day in style, before heading next door to the owner’s pub, Sun Trevor, where you can indulge in a tasty home-cooked meal and local ales. A blissful escape in the heart of North Wales, don’t miss out on Barn 1. Note: This property can be booked with Refs: 980404 and 980405 together sleeping 20 guests.
